This filter is made from 316L stainless steel alloy that is nonferromagnetic and is MR compatible. It has a dual level arrangement with 6 short hooked legs to ensure fixation to the caval wall and 3 longer legs for centering. It requires a 7F system for insertion. It is approved...

read full descriptionThis is a newer design that is based on the Günther Tulip filter and designed to be more easily retrievable. It is made of Conichrome® which is a cobalt- chromium-nickel-molybdenum-iron alloy. It has a single-cone design and incorporates secondary struts, designed to centre the filter...
read full descriptionThe Optease filter is a retrievable filter that can be inserted via femoral, jugular or antecubital routes. The filter comes compressed in a plastic tube for insertion, marked for the appropriate insertion route. This nitinol hypotube filter is a modified version of the permanent TrapEase...
